Product details
Overview
TLE4998C8XUMA2 from Infineon is a dual-die programmable linear Hall sensor IC with integrated 20-bit DSP, digital temperature/stress compensation, and SPC (Short PWM Code) output compliant with SAE J2716 SENT protocol. It delivers 16-bit resolution, ±50/±100/±200 mT configurable magnetic range, and operates from −40°C to +125°C. Used in automotive pedal position, throttle position, and steering torque sensing where high accuracy and AEC-Q100 compliance are mandatory.

Technical Context
The TLE4998C8XUMA2 integrates two independent Hall sensor dies in a single PG-TDSO-8 package, each with its own 20-bit DSP core, digital temperature compensation using second-order coefficients, and open-drain SPC output. It supports three SPC modes: synchronous transmission, dynamic range selection, and ID-selectable bus operation for up to four sensors on one line.
Its BiCMOS process enables reverse-polarity protection, 4.1–16 V extended supply range, and robust diagnostics including EEPROM error correction, overvoltage detection, and internal magnetic field/temperature reporting. The sensor uses chopped Hall elements and continuous-time A/D conversion to minimize magnetic offset drift over lifetime and temperature.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Output Protocol | SPC (Short PWM Code) based on SAE J2716 SENT - enables ECU-initiated transmissions and diagnostic nibble embedding. |
| Resolution | 16-bit overall resolution - supports precise linear/angular position quantization with <1 LSB total error over temperature. |
| Magnetic Range | Programmable ±50 mT / ±100 mT / ±200 mT - allows optimization for low-noise pedal sensing or wide-range throttle applications. |
| Operating Temp | −40°C to +125°C - qualified per AEC-Q100 Grade 0, enabling direct placement in engine bay or brake module environments. |
| Supply Voltage | 4.5–5.5 V nominal (4.1–16 V extended) - accommodates battery transients and simplifies power design in 12 V automotive systems. |
| Diagnostics | On-board EEPROM error correction, overvoltage detection, and internal temperature/magnetic field readback - reduces need for external monitoring circuitry. |
| Protection | Reverse-polarity, output short-circuit, and ±2 kV HBM ESD protection - ensures reliability in harsh assembly and field conditions. |

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Two-point magnetic calibration | Enables field-to-digital transfer function setup without iterative loops - reduces production test time and calibration complexity. |
| Digital temperature compensation | Second-order coefficient storage in EEPROM - eliminates need for external thermistors or lookup tables in ECU firmware. |
| Reprogrammable EEPROM | Single-bit error correction and user-lock capability - supports post-soldering parameter tuning and secure final configuration. |
| SPC bus mode with ID selection | Supports up to 4 sensors on shared VDD/OUT lines - cuts wiring harness weight and connector count in multi-axis modules. |
| Internal diagnostics reporting | Real-time output of raw magnetic field and die temperature - enables predictive maintenance and fault isolation without additional sensors. |

FAQ
What is the difference between TLE4998C8XUMA2 and TLE4998C8D?
The TLE4998C8XUMA2 contains a single Hall sensor die in PG-TDSO-8-1 package, while TLE4998C8D integrates two independent dies in PG-TDSO-8-2. Pinouts differ: pins 5–8 are NC in XUMA2 but active (OUT/GND/VDD/TST) for the second die in C8D. Both share identical electrical specs and programming features.
Does TLE4998C8XUMA2 require an external pull-up resistor on the OUT pin?
Yes - the OUT pin is open-drain. A pull-up resistor to the receiver supply (e.g., 3.3 V or 5 V) is mandatory. Typical value is 2.2 kΩ; lower values improve rise time but increase current draw during low state. No internal pull-up is present.
Can magnetic range and sensitivity be reprogrammed after soldering?
Yes - all parameters (magnetic range, gain, offset, polarity, bandwidth, clamping, and temperature coefficients) are stored in EEPROM and can be reprogrammed in-system via the SPC interface until memory lock is enabled. Locking is irreversible and performed once final calibration is complete.
Is TLE4998C8XUMA2 qualified for ASIL-B or ASIL-C systems?
While not ASIL-certified itself, the TLE4998C8XUMA2 is AEC-Q100 Grade 0 qualified and includes PRO-SIL™ safety features (diagnostics, EEPROM ECC, fail-safe outputs). It is widely used in ASIL-B and ASIL-C subsystems when integrated with appropriate system-level safety mechanisms per ISO 26262.
